Abstract

The application provides a control method, a system, a device and a storage medium of an air conditioning device, wherein the method comprises the following steps: the method comprises the steps of communicating with a water heater arranged in a bathroom to obtain use data of the water heater, wherein the use data comprise water outlet flow, water outlet time and/or water outlet temperature, judging the use mode of the water heater according to the use data of the water heater, and adjusting the operation mode of the air conditioning device if the use mode of the water heater is a bathing mode. This application controls air conditioning equipment according to the mode of bathing of water heater and adjusts the outdoor indoor air temperature of bathroom to the user after avoiding having bathed gets cold.

Technical Field
The present disclosure relates to home devices, and particularly to a method, a system, a device, and a storage medium for controlling an air conditioning device.
Background
When people take a bath, because the water vapor in the relatively closed bathroom evaporates, the humidity in the bathroom can be higher, and when people finish taking a bath and go out from the bathroom, the skin of the human body is more or less covered with the water vapor, the water vapor on the skin of the human body contacts with new air outside the bathroom or meets cold air, the water vapor attached to the surface of the skin of the human body absorbs heat and evaporates, and the people can be cooled suddenly. Particularly, in autumn and winter with low temperature, when people go out from a bathroom with high temperature after bathing, the temperature outside the bathroom is lower than that in the bathroom, the temperature difference between the inside and the outside of the bathroom is large, and water vapor on the surface of a human body is evaporated more quickly when encountering cold air, so that people are easy to catch cold and get ill.
Therefore, how to prevent the people who have just bathed from catching a cold easily due to the large temperature difference between the inside and the outside of the bathroom is a problem to be solved urgently at present.

Referring to fig. 1, fig. 1 is a flowchart illustrating a control method of an air conditioning device according to an embodiment of the present disclosure.
As shown in fig. 1, the control method of the air conditioning device includes steps S101 to S103.
Step S101, communicating with a water heater arranged in a bathroom to acquire use data of the water heater, wherein the use data comprise water outlet flow, water outlet time and/or water outlet temperature.
For example, the water heater installed in the bathroom may include a gas water heater, an indoor portion of a solar water heater, an instant electric water heater, a storage electric water heater, a magnetic water heater, an air energy water heater, a heating water heater, and the like.
For example, the water heater is provided with a detection device for detecting whether the water heater is used, the water outlet flow and/or the water outlet temperature.
The water heater is also provided with a detection device communication circuit used for sending the use data detected by the detection device to the air conditioning device and/or the mobile equipment.
Illustratively, the usage data of the water heater comprises water outlet flow, water outlet time and/or water outlet temperature, wherein the water outlet flow is the total water outlet flow of the water outlet after the water heater is started at a certain moment in the day and can be measured by a flow meter arranged at the water outlet; the water outlet time is the time period from the time when the user turns on the water heater to the time when the user turns off the water heater; the outlet water temperature is the actual temperature of the water temperature at the water outlet of the water heater and can be measured through the temperature sensor.
For example, the air conditioning device is communicated with a water heater arranged in a bathroom, and communication connection can be established with the water heater through Bluetooth and/or WiFi. Specifically, the air conditioning device may search for an identifier of the water heater within the preset range by actively turning on the bluetooth and/or WIFI function of the air conditioning device, or the air conditioning device passively turns on the bluetooth and/or WIFI function to establish a communication connection with the water heater within the preset range when receiving a connection request of the water heater.
For example, after a water heater provided in a bathroom is turned on, an identifier of an air conditioning device within a preset distance range is searched for, and a connection request is sent to the corresponding air conditioning device based on the searched identifier of the air conditioning device. And after receiving the connection request of the water heater, the air conditioning device turns on Bluetooth and/or WiFi as a response and establishes communication connection with the water heater.
In some embodiments, the step of the air conditioning device actively acquiring the usage data of the water heater is: the method comprises the steps of starting Bluetooth and/or WiFi to search the identification of the water heater within a preset distance range, sending a connection request to the corresponding water heater based on the searched identification of the water heater, receiving a response returned by the water heater based on the connection request, and establishing communication connection with the water heater based on the response. Then, based on the communication connection, an acquisition request for acquiring the usage data is sent to the water heater at a preset interval. The preset distance range can be flexibly set according to actual needs, and the preset time can also be flexibly set according to actual needs.
In other embodiments, the mobile terminal may also establish a communication connection with the water heater in advance, so as to continuously acquire the usage data of the water heater from the water heater, and then the air detection device acquires the usage data of the water heater from the mobile terminal.
And S102, judging the use mode of the water heater according to the use data, wherein the use mode comprises a bathing mode.
For example, the air conditioning device may determine the usage pattern of the water heater according to whether the acquired usage data of the water heater satisfies a determination threshold set by a user. Specifically, the method for judging the use mode of the water heater according to the use data of the water heater comprises the following steps: if the water outlet time of the water heater reaches a preset time threshold value, judging that the use mode of the water heater is a bathing mode; or if the water outlet temperature of the water heater reaches a preset temperature threshold value, determining that the use mode of the water heater is a bathing mode; or if the water outlet time reaches a preset time threshold value and the water outlet temperature reaches a preset temperature threshold value, judging that the use mode of the water heater is a bathing mode. The manner of determining the usage mode of the water heater may be determined according to a form in which a threshold is preset by a user.
For example, when the user only sets the water outlet time threshold in advance, but does not set the threshold of the water outlet temperature, the air conditioning device may determine that the current usage mode of the water heater is the bathing mode only according to the fact that the water outlet time of the water heater reaches the preset time threshold; or the user only presets the water outlet temperature threshold of the water heater but does not set the water outlet time threshold, and the air conditioning device can judge that the current use mode of the hot water vapor is bathing only according to the judgment that the water outlet temperature of the water heater reaches the preset temperature threshold; or the user sets the water outlet time threshold and the water outlet temperature threshold in advance, the air conditioning device needs to judge whether the obtained water outlet time and the obtained water outlet temperature of the water heater simultaneously meet the preset time threshold and the preset temperature threshold to judge the use mode of the water heater, and if the obtained water outlet time and the obtained water outlet temperature simultaneously meet the preset time threshold and the preset temperature threshold, the current use mode of the water heater is judged to be the bathing mode.
In other embodiments, determining the usage pattern of the water heater according to the usage data of the water heater includes: the method comprises the steps of obtaining the water outlet time and the water outlet flow of the water heater, judging whether the water outlet time of the water heater reaches a preset time threshold value, judging whether the water outlet flow of the water heater reaches a preset flow threshold value if the water outlet time of the water heater reaches the preset time threshold value, and judging that the use mode of the water heater is a bathing mode if the water outlet flow of the water heater reaches the preset flow threshold value. After the air conditioning device acquires the use data from the water heater, the water outlet time and the water outlet flow of the water heater are acquired from the use data, whether the water outlet time of the water heater reaches a time threshold preset by a user is judged, and the time threshold can be input by the user through an input device of the air conditioning device or sent to the air conditioning device through a mobile terminal. If the obtained water outlet time of the water heater reaches a time threshold preset by a user, comparing the water outlet flow of the water heater with a preset flow threshold, wherein the water outlet flow is the total water outlet flow in the water outlet time of the water heater, and if the total water outlet flow reaches the preset flow threshold, determining that the current use mode of the water heater is a bathing mode. That is, if it is determined that the water heater is in the bathing mode, the water outlet time of the water heater first reaches the preset time threshold, and then the total water outlet flow rate in the water outlet time also reaches the preset flow rate threshold, it is determined that the current usage mode of the water heater is the bathing mode.
And S103, if the using mode of the water heater is the bathing mode, adjusting the operating mode of the air conditioning device to avoid the user catching a cold.
For example, when the air conditioning device can determine that the usage mode of the water heater is the bathing mode according to the acquired usage data, the air conditioning device operates the mode corresponding to the current bathing mode of the water heater, or adjusts the operation mode according to the acquired data of the surrounding environment.
Specifically, the air conditioning device operates a mode corresponding to a current bathing mode of the water heater, including: and acquiring the temperature of the surrounding environment of the air conditioning device, comparing the water outlet temperature of the water heater with the temperature of the surrounding environment of the air conditioning device to obtain a comparison result, and adjusting the operation mode of the air conditioning device according to the comparison result. The temperature of the surrounding environment of the air conditioning device can be acquired through a temperature sensor arranged on the air conditioning device, or the temperature in the household central temperature regulation and control device is acquired through a wireless local area network and is used as the temperature of the surrounding environment. And then comparing the temperature of the water outlet water of the water heater with the obtained temperature of the outlet water of the water heater to obtain a comparison result, and adjusting the air conditioning device to operate in a corresponding mode according to the comparison result.
In some embodiments, adjusting the respective operation mode of the air conditioning device based on the obtained comparison result includes: if the temperature of the environment around the air conditioning device is lower than the water outlet temperature of the water heater, the target refrigerating temperature of the air conditioning device is increased; and/or if the temperature of the environment around the air conditioning device is lower than the water outlet temperature of the water heater, starting the warm air mode of the air conditioning device; and/or if the temperature of the environment around the air conditioning device is lower than the water outlet temperature of the water heater, the air conditioning device avoids air supply by people.
Since the air conditioning device may include an air conditioner, a fan heater, a fan, etc., adjusting the corresponding operation mode of the air conditioning device may adjust the temperature of the air inside the user's bathroom according to the device owned by the user. For example, when the air conditioning device is an air conditioner, if the temperature of the ambient environment obtained when the water heater is in the bathing mode is lower than the outlet water temperature of the water heater, the target cooling temperature of the air conditioner is increased, and the increased target cooling temperature value can be increased by taking the difference between the outlet water temperature and the ambient environment temperature as an increase range; similarly, when the air conditioning device is a fan heater, the fan heater starts a hot air mode to operate; when the air conditioning device is a fan, the fan supplies air in a direction avoiding the position of the user according to the position of the user. The position of the user can acquire coordinate information (with the position of the fan as a coordinate origin) of the user relative to the air conditioning device (i.e., the fan) by using any one of a bluetooth positioning method, an ultrasonic positioning method, a WiFi positioning method and a ZigBee positioning method. Then, the fan blows air in the position direction after the angle is shifted according to the fan blowing shift angle set by the user (for example, the shift is set to 30 degrees) based on the determined position of the user. The air supply deviation angle of the fan can be set by a user according to the needs of the user, and the user does not limit the specific content.
In some embodiments, if the usage mode of the water heater is a bathing mode, adjusting the operation mode of the air conditioning device further comprises: acquiring the temperature of a bathroom, and adjusting the air conditioning device to supply air at a temperature not lower than that of the bathroom; or the body surface temperature of the user after bathing is obtained, and the air conditioning device is adjusted to refrigerate at the body surface temperature of the user.
For example, a water heater installed in a bathroom may be provided with a detection device having a temperature sensor, the temperature sensor may acquire a temperature of the bathroom, when the air conditioning device determines that a usage mode of the water heater is a bathing mode according to usage data of the water heater, the detection device sends an instruction for acquiring the temperature to the detection device, and after receiving the instruction for acquiring the temperature from the air conditioning device, the detection device sends the acquired temperature to the air detection device through a communication circuit, or sends the acquired temperature to a mobile terminal through a communication circuit, and the temperature is forwarded to the air conditioning device through the mobile terminal. Then, the air conditioning device compares the acquired ambient temperature with the water outlet temperature of the water heater to obtain a comparison result, and adjusts the air conditioning device to supply air at a temperature not lower than that of the bathroom according to the obtained comparison result.
In other embodiments, the body surface temperature of the user after bathing is obtained, and the temperature of a preset position of the user (for example, the back of the user) can be detected by an infrared sensor arranged in a bathroom, and the temperature of the position is used as the body surface temperature of the user. Specifically, after the air conditioning device judges that the user has finished bathing according to the change of the water outlet flow of the water heater in unit time, the air conditioning device sends a control command to control the infrared sensor to scan the area where the user is located so as to obtain scanning data, and the scanning data is obtained. And then generating a thermal imaging image according to the scanning data, identifying a preset position of the user from the thermal imaging image, detecting the temperature of the preset position of the user and taking the temperature as the body surface temperature. After obtaining the body surface temperature of the user, the air conditioning device adjusts the current operation mode to refrigerate with the body surface temperature of the user so as to provide the environment temperature suitable for the body surface temperature of the user.
According to the control method of the air conditioning device provided by the embodiment, the use data of the water heater is obtained through communication with the water heater arranged in the bathroom, the use mode of the water heater is judged according to the outlet water flow, the outlet water time and/or the outlet water temperature in the obtained use data of the water heater, and if the use mode of the water heater is the bathing mode, the air conditioning device is adjusted to operate in the corresponding mode, so that the appropriate indoor temperature can be provided for a user who has bathed, and the user is prevented from catching a cold.
Referring to fig. 2, fig. 2 is a schematic flow chart illustrating another control method of an air conditioning device according to an embodiment of the present disclosure.
As shown in fig. 2, the control method of the air conditioning device includes steps S201 to 205.
Step S201, communicating with a water heater arranged in a bathroom to acquire use data of the water heater, wherein the use data comprise water outlet flow, water outlet time and/or water outlet temperature.
For example, the water heater has a communication circuit electrically connected with a detection device and a data acquisition device, and the detection device and the data acquisition device can be arranged on the water heater, wherein the detection device is used for detecting information of a user and/or environmental data of a bathroom; the data acquisition device is used for acquiring the use data of the water heater. The communication circuit can send water heater usage data to the air conditioning unit and/or the mobile device.
For example, the communication with the water heater arranged in the bathroom can be realized through Bluetooth and/or WiFi. Specifically, the air conditioning device may search for an identifier of the water heater within the preset range by actively turning on the bluetooth and/or WIFI function of the air conditioning device, or the air conditioning device passively turns on the bluetooth and/or WIFI function to establish a communication connection with the water heater within the preset range when receiving a connection request of the water heater.
And S202, judging the use mode of the water heater according to the use data, wherein the use mode comprises a bathing mode.
For example, the air conditioning device may determine the usage pattern of the water heater according to whether the acquired usage data of the water heater satisfies a determination threshold set by a user. Specifically, the method for judging the use mode of the water heater according to the use data of the water heater comprises the following steps: if the water outlet time of the water heater reaches a preset time threshold value, judging that the use mode of the water heater is a bathing mode; or if the water outlet temperature of the water heater reaches a preset temperature threshold value, determining that the use mode of the water heater is a bathing mode; or if the water outlet time reaches a preset time threshold value and the water outlet temperature reaches a preset temperature threshold value, judging that the use mode of the water heater is a bathing mode.
And S203, if the using mode of the water heater is the bathing mode, acquiring the identity information of the user.
For example, the obtaining of the user identity information may be by obtaining at least one of voiceprint information, fingerprint information, facial feature information, and body feature information of the user. And matching corresponding information acquisition equipment according to different forms of the identity information to be acquired. For example, when facial feature information or body feature information of a subject of use is acquired, the facial feature information or body feature information may be acquired by a video camera and/or a still camera and/or a home appliance having a camera function and/or a photographing function. Similarly, the voiceprint information (or the voice command information) can be acquired through a dedicated device for acquiring voice (which can be arranged in a detection device installed in the water heater) or a household appliance with a voice information acquisition function. Similarly, the fingerprint information may be acquired by a fingerprint acquisition device installed in the bathroom, such as a water heater or a door lock with a fingerprint identification device.
After the identity information of the user is recognized by the identity recognition device, the air conditioning device can communicate with the identity recognition device to acquire the identity information of the user, or the identity recognition device synchronizes the identity recognition information to the cloud end, and the air conditioning device acquires the identity information of the user from the cloud end.
And step S204, determining habit data of the user according to the identity information.
After the air conditioning device acquires the identity information of the user, the identity of the user currently used by the water heater can be determined according to the acquired identity information, and then habit data of the user is determined according to the determined identity.
Specifically, the identity of the user currently using the water heater is determined according to the acquired identity information, and the identity of the user currently using the water heater is determined by comparing the acquired identity information with at least one preset information in the information base under the condition that the acquired identity information is the same as the current preset information. The preset information refers to information which is matched with the specific identity of the user and is pre-stored in an information base. When at least one user object is arranged in a user home, preset information corresponding to the respective identity of each user object is prestored in the information base, so that when the identity information of the current user is obtained, the obtained identity information can be compared with each piece of prestored preset information, the preset information matched with the current user object is found, and the identity of the user using the water heater at present is determined according to the preset information. And then determining habit data controlled by the air conditioning device corresponding to the user identity according to the determined user identity so as to control the operation of the air conditioning device.
For example, in a case where the acquired identity information is different from each preset information in the information base, the user may be prompted to fail to identify the user, so as to prompt the user to re-enter the pre-stored information into the information base.
And S205, adjusting the operation mode of the air conditioning device according to the habit data and the water outlet temperature of the water heater.
Referring to fig. 3, fig. 3 is a schematic diagram of the air conditioning device for adjusting the cooling temperature according to the present embodiment.
After determining habit data of a user for controlling the air conditioning device, adjusting the operation of the air conditioning device based on the habit data of the user and in combination with the outlet water temperature of the water heater.
For example, when the determined identity is user a, the habit data of user a is a preference for selecting a fan heater in the air conditioning device to directionally supply the warm air. Then the warm air blower is combined with the water outlet temperature of the water heater to adjust the operation mode, for example, when the water outlet temperature of the water heater is 40 ℃, the warm air blower is adjusted to directionally send warm air of the first gear; when the water outlet temperature of the water heater is 42 ℃, the fan heater is adjusted to directionally send two-stage warm air. And when the determined identity is the user B, the habit data of the user B is that the user B likes to select air-conditioning refrigeration in the air-conditioning device, when the outlet water temperature of the water heater is 40 ℃, the temperature of the air-conditioning refrigeration is adjusted to be 28 ℃, and when the outlet water temperature of the water heater is 42 ℃, the refrigeration temperature of the air-conditioning is adjusted to be 30 ℃. As shown in fig. 3, when the air conditioner is an air conditioner, the obtained outlet water temperature of the water heater is 42 degrees, and the air conditioner adjusts the target cooling temperature to be 30 ℃, so as to provide the indoor temperature of 30 ℃ to the user.
In the control method of the air conditioning device provided by the embodiment, when the usage mode of the water heater in the bathroom is determined to be the bathing mode according to the acquired usage data of the water heater, the identity information of the user is acquired to determine the identity of the user and the habit data of the user, and the operation mode of the air conditioning device is adjusted to provide the appropriate ambient temperature for the user according to the habit data and the outlet water temperature of the water heater, so that the user is prevented from catching a cold after bathing.
